Neste artigo você vai aprender a como iterar em dicionários utilizando for – para que você possa acessar cada item no seu dicionário em Python com um loop.

iterar em dicionários utilizando for

Fala galera, beleza? Bora aprender mais sobre dicionários e Python com este artigo!

Basicamente o dicionário é um conjunto de chaves e valores, que em outras linguanges é representado por array associativo

E também o dicionário do Python tem uma estrutura bem próxima do objeto em JavaScript

Dito isso, como acessar um dicionário com um for? Lendo suas chaves e valores

Muito simples! Vamos utilizar o método items e fazer um loop com for, veja o exemplo prático:

pecas = {
  'portas': 2,
  'janelas': 4,
  'motor': 1,
  'pneus': 4
}

for key, value in pecas.items():
  print(key, ' => ', value)

A saída desta expressão será:

portas  =>  2
janelas  =>  4
motor  =>  1
pneus  =>  4

Veja como é simples, apenas criamos duas variáveis temporárias, que são: key e value

A key representa a chave dos valores do dicionário, e a value vai representa todos os valores de cada chave, entendeu?

Dessa forma é possível acessar as chaves e valores, ou apenas o que você deseja para a lógica do seu programa

Conclusão

Neste artigo vimos como iterar em dicionários utilizando for na linguagem Python

É bem interessante pois o método items nos dá o acesso a os itens e também chaves do dicionário, basta criar as variáveis temporárias no for

Confira também nosso catálogo de cursos gratuitos, com aulas semanais no YouTube

Subscribe
Notify of
guest

0 Comentários
Inline Feedbacks
View all comments